[Autorun] bonsoir

bizertin -  
 Utilisateur anonyme -
Salut, merci pour votre collaboration.
J'ai crée un fichier hela.bat où j'ai ecris une commande.
Dans un fichier autorun j'ai mis open=hela.bat mais le fichier hela.bat ne s'ouvre pas automatiquement, et je me trouve obligé de cliquer sur hela.bat pour executer le commande.
S.V.P comment faire pour exécuté automatiquement hela.bat dés l'insertion du cd.
amicalement.
A voir également:

4 réponses

p.legal Messages postés 89 Statut Membre 24
 
Il faut creer un fichier autorun.inf dans lequel tu ecrit les commandes suivantes.

[autorun]
open=prog.bat
icon=prog.ico

ce fichier doit être placé à la racine de ton CD.

@++
0
bizertin
 
Salut, merci pour votre collaboration.
J'ai effectué les opérations avec succé, mais reste un probléme, car je veux lancer le fichier .exe de mon travail(Bizerte_005.exe) directement après le lancement du fichier prog.bat. C'est à dire autorun pour deux fichiers successive. J'ai essayé dans autorun.inf les lignes suivante:
[autorun]
open=prog.bat
open=Bizerte_005.exe
icon=Bizerte005.ico

mais seulement le fichier prog.bat qui s'execut, et je dois entrer manuellement pour faire démarrer le cd.
Si vous m'aidez je serais très content.
merci
0
p.legal Messages postés 89 Statut Membre 24
 
Il faut lancer votre programme .exe depuis votre fichier .bat avant de se fermer.

@++
0
bizertin
 
Salut, merci infiniment pour votre aide.
J'ai mis dans le fichier prog.bat les lignes suivante:
copy JMC_EDUS.INI%WINDIR%
open=Bizerte_005.exe

Dans le fichier autorun.inf j'ai ecris:
[autorun]
open=prog.bat
icon=Bizerte005.ico

Mais toujours seulement la première ligne du fichier prog.bat qui s'execute et je dois entrer dans la racine du CD pour cliquer su le fichier executable Bizerte_005.exe
Je suis sûr que vous pouver me trouver une solution.
Merci d'avance
0
Utilisateur anonyme
 
Bonjour,

à cette ligne, je ne vois pas l'espace entre la source et la destination ???
copy JMC_EDUS.INI%WINDIR%

utiliser plûtôt :
xcopy JMC_EDUS.INI %WINDIR%

et sur la ligne :

open=Bizerte_005.exe

il existe peut-être un paramètre sur l'appel, ex:
 
open="Bizerte_005.exe /y"

autre question que je me pose, comment démarrer sur un CD
sans charger de pilote pour celui-ci ???

Lupin
0
bizertin
 
Salut, merci pour votre collaboration.
J'ai modifier les lignes, mais sans succé. Je cherche toujours à lancer les 2 fichiers en même temps ( prog.bat et Bizerte_005.exe)
Merci pour votre aide.
0
Utilisateur anonyme
 
Bonjour,

Autres idées ...

Dans un fichier en lot (*.bat), je n'ai jamais utiliser l'instruction
[ open ]. Lorsque je veux appeller un autre programme, je l'appelle
simplement, sans l'instruction "open".

ex.:

prog.bat
  Bizerte_005.exe


est-tu certain que ton OS reconnais les noms longs ?

essayer de renommer Bizerte_005.exe pour Bizerte.exe
( <= 8 caractères ).

Lupin
0